摘要
A simple, inexpensive, reliable and environmentally friendly procedure based on ultrasound-assisted extraction combined with ultrasound-assisted emulsification microextraction based on applying low density organic solvent followed by gas chromatography-flame ionization detection has been developed for the simultaneous determination of permethrin and deltamethrin in spinach samples. Parameters affecting the extraction process have been optimized. Under the optimum conditions, the calibration plots were linear in the range of 0.01-20 mg/kg with the determination coefficient (r2) higher than 0.990. The limits of detection were 0.007 and 0.006 mg/kg for deltamethrin and permethrin, respectively, which are lower than the maximum residue levels established by various official organizations. The proposed procedure has high potential for the use as a sensitive method for the determination of deltamethrin and permethrin residues in spinach samples.
